Job description

Key Responsibilities Complaints Management Support the management and administration of patient complaints and concerns received from patients, relatives, carers and third-party organisations. Acknowledge complaints verbally and in writing in a timely and professional manner. Support the investigation of complaints, including gathering information and liaising with relevant colleagues. Draft clear, accurate, and professional complaint response letters for review by the Governance, Compliance and Risk Lead. Maintain accurate records of complaints and outcomes in line with ACF procedures. Incident Management Support the investigation and administration of clinical and non-clinical incidents. Maintain incident records accurately and confidentially. Support the monitoring and reporting of incidents, trends and learning outcomes. Assist in implementing actions arising from incident investigations and lessons learned. Governance, Compliance and Risk Provide administrative support for non-clinical governance, compliance and risk management activities across the organisation. Support the development, review, implementation and administration of organisational policies, procedures and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s). Support the creation, review, and maintenance of organisational risk assessments and risk registers. Help ensure compliance with relevant regulatory and organisational requirements. Health and Safety Support the implementation and administration of health and safety policies and procedures. Assist with health and safety audits, inspections and compliance monitoring activities. Support the investigation and recording of health and safety incidents and near misses. Promote a positive health and safety culture across the organisation. Premises and Facilities Support Assist with premises management activities across a multi-site organisation. Support compliance activities relating to buildings, facilities and workplace safety. Liaise with internal teams and external contractors where required to ensure premises-related issues are managed effectively. Safeguarding and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S) Complete safeguarding awareness training to the level required for a non-clinical member of staff, within the agreed induction period and keep this current through scheduled refresher training. Maintain a working awareness of ACF's safeguarding referral pathways, recognising when a concern should be escalated and to whom. Support the administration of safeguarding records and referrals as directed by the Governance, Compliance and Risk Lead, maintaining strict confidentiality at all times. General Responsibilities Maintain confidentiality and handle sensitive information appropriately at all times. Produce reports, correspondence and documentation to a high professional standard. Support governance meetings through agenda preparation, minute-taking and action tracking where required. Work closely with clinical and non-clinical staff, patients, external agencies and contractors as the role requires. Adhere to ACF policies, including information governance, health and safety and equality and diversity. Undertake any other duties commensurate with the grade and purpose of the role. This job description is not exhaustive and will be reviewed in partnership with the post-holder.
